Scale Matters: How I Choose the Right Large Abstract for Each Space

Smart sizing improves spatial balance and how your wall communicates.

I always measure furniture and wall span so the piece sits with purpose. For sofas about 6–7.5 feet wide, a 48×60 large abstract is often ideal.

Vendors frequently have bespoke dimensions and DIY stretching systems. Those options streamline setup and install and keep shipping simple.

48×60 And Beyond: Matching Big Art To Each Room

I align canvas width with furniture: over a dining table, I track the furniture length and keep a small clearance above.

In offices, I opt for a single statement canvas that sits just above shelving so the composition can read cleanly.

Single statement vs. diptych: balancing wall width and ceiling height

“For very wide walls, a diptych can cover the distance without overweighting a single panel.”

  • I lean vertical when ceilings are high and wider 48×60 canvases for regular-height rooms.
  • I place centers at about 57–60 inches eye level, modifying for chair height.
  • When walls are tight, I pick slimmer panels or coordinated pairs to keep rhythm.
Wall Type Typical Size Guideline
Sofa wall 48×60 Keep equal side margins
Dining wall Similar to table length Keep bottom edge several inches above surface
Very wide wall Diptych / extra-large Split for lighter handling and visual balance

Making Big Abstracts Work In Every Room

When I style wall art, I coordinate dimensions, tones, and texture to make the composition feel deliberate and lived-in.

Living Room Impact: Color/Furniture Pairing

I usually center the XL piece over the sofa and repeat a couple of core hues in pillows and a throw. That creates a simple, cohesive link between the piece and the seating area.

I maintain simple furniture lines when the wall is strong so the artwork can set the tone. Then I bring in one metallic touch to pick up any gold leaf or shimmer.

If the palette is navy and white, I bring in oak and a nubby rug. Those choices stop the space from feeling cold and make the living room inviting.

Dining & Office Focus: Neutral, Blue, Monochrome

In the dining room I center the canvas over the table and choose neutral or blue white themes that stay background-friendly during meals.

For a modern office, black-and-white pieces define the zone with clarity. I mix in a plant or timber desk for organic balance and to steady the visual weight.

  • Long walls get balance with a lean floor lamp or narrow console so the composition feels designed.
  • Low ceilings call for wider orientations to widen the visual field.
  • I layer ambient, task, and accent lighting so textures and colors stay legible 24/7.
